Milrinone-d3

Description:
Milrinone-d3 is a deuterated form of milrinone, a phosphodiesterase inhibitor primarily used in the treatment of heart failure. As a chemical substance, it retains the core structure of milrinone but incorporates deuterium atoms, which are heavier isotopes of hydrogen. This modification can enhance the stability and metabolic tracking of the compound in pharmacokinetic studies. Milrinone itself is known for its ability to increase cardiac output and improve myocardial contractility by inhibiting the breakdown of cyclic AMP, leading to vasodilation and improved blood flow. The deuterated version, Milrinone-d3, is often utilized in research settings, particularly in studies involving drug metabolism and pharmacodynamics, as it allows for more precise measurements and analysis due to its distinct isotopic signature. The CAS number 2749393-50-6 uniquely identifies this compound in chemical databases, facilitating its recognition and study in scientific literature. Overall, Milrinone-d3 serves as a valuable tool in both clinical and research applications related to cardiovascular health.
